summaryrefslogtreecommitdiff
path: root/systemd/disable_nss_module.go
diff options
context:
space:
mode:
Diffstat (limited to 'systemd/disable_nss_module.go')
-rw-r--r--systemd/disable_nss_module.go16
1 files changed, 9 insertions, 7 deletions
diff --git a/systemd/disable_nss_module.go b/systemd/disable_nss_module.go
index da86582..9a8b388 100644
--- a/systemd/disable_nss_module.go
+++ b/systemd/disable_nss_module.go
@@ -1,6 +1,6 @@
// Copyright (C) 2006 West Consulting
// Copyright (C) 2006-2015 Arthur de Jong
-// Copyright (C) 2015 Luke Shumaker <lukeshu@sbcglobal.net>
+// Copyright (C) 2015-2016 Luke Shumaker <lukeshu@sbcglobal.net>
//
// This library is free software; you can redistribute it and/or
// modify it under the terms of the GNU Lesser General Public
@@ -20,8 +20,10 @@
package nslcd_systemd
import (
+ "fmt"
+
"lukeshu.com/git/go/libgnulinux.git/dl"
- "lukeshu.com/git/go/libsystemd.git/sd_daemon/logger"
+ sd "lukeshu.com/git/go/libsystemd.git/sd_daemon"
)
//static char *strary(char **ary, unsigned int n) { return ary[n]; }
@@ -38,22 +40,22 @@ func disable_nss_module() {
if err == nil {
defer handle.Close()
} else {
- logger.Warning("NSS module %s not loaded: %v", nss_module_soname, err)
+ sd.Log.Warning(fmt.Sprintf("NSS module %s not loaded: %v", nss_module_soname, err))
return
}
c_version_info, err := handle.Sym(nss_module_sym_version)
if err == nil {
g_version_info := (**C.char)(c_version_info)
- logger.Debug("NSS module %s version %s %s", nss_module_soname,
+ sd.Log.Debug(fmt.Sprintf("NSS module %s version %s %s", nss_module_soname,
C.GoString(C.strary(g_version_info, 0)),
- C.GoString(C.strary(g_version_info, 1)))
+ C.GoString(C.strary(g_version_info, 1))))
} else {
- logger.Warning("NSS module %s version missing: %v", nss_module_soname, err)
+ sd.Log.Warning(fmt.Sprintf("NSS module %s version missing: %v", nss_module_soname, err))
}
c_enable_flag, err := handle.Sym(nss_module_sym_enablelookups)
if err != nil {
- logger.Warning("Unable to disable NSS ldap module for nslcd process: %v", err)
+ sd.Log.Warning(fmt.Sprintf("Unable to disable NSS ldap module for nslcd process: %v", err))
return
}
g_enable_flag := (*C.int)(c_enable_flag)